A 6.6 km night fell race to the 703 m summit of Chapelfell Top in Weardale. The unmarked, pathless out and back gains 370 m and requires off path navigation experience and strict mandatory kit.
A 7 km undulating trail run on the edge of Brampton, Cumbria. The off-road route offers mixed terrain and scenic views. Finishers get a bespoke medal and free event photos.
A circular trail race of about 17.5 miles around Robin Hoods Bay, following the Cinder Track and Cleveland Way. The course has three staffed checkpoints with food and drink and an overall 8 hour time limit.
A circular, approximately 30 mile winter trail race from Robin Hood's Bay through Ravenscar, Crookness and Scalby Mills with 3400 ft of ascent, staffed checkpoints with refreshments, mandatory winter kit and an 11 hour time limit.

Thirteen day end to end ultra across England covering 503 miles from Gretna Green to Lands End. Field limited to 20 competitors; organisers provide personalised kit, daily medals and a finisher trophy.
A single day 37.6 mile ultra from Gretna Green to Penrith, the MTC Boggart is Day 1 of the MTC ALBION end to end of England. Entries are limited, mandatory kit is required and all finishers receive a medal.
